Gear problems
Hey guys,
So I'm finally putting my 911sc in this week for its road worthy certificate. I have taken it on a few drives and its seems to be pretty happy after is restoration but for some reason after today I couldn't put it into second or fourth gear?? What the hell is going on!! I hope it hasn't been damaged I'm really ****ting myself and hoping its a quick fix! what could it be? |

You need to adjust the coupler in the access in the back seat, check the bushings in the coupler
That's the first place I would go. Bruce |
